Simulation Analysis of Structure Parameters of Jet-mixing Apparatus on Jet-mixing Performance
摘要
Abstract
Aimed at optimizing the structure of jet-mixing apparatus, effect of three main structure parameters: nozzle-tube distance, area ratio and entrainment angle on the mixing performance were investigated based on CFD technique. A mathematical model for jet apparatus was established and validated by actual experimental data. Simulated results and experiment results showed that the established model was reasonable. The results indicated that nozzle-tube distance, area ratio and entrainment angle would not change the tendency of h - q with the increasing of flow ratio. However, both nozzle-tube distance and entrainment angle would not change the tendency oi n - q except for area ratio.关键词
